  3. Economic Development Delivery Structure

  4. 4KeySectors We have real advantages (and could do better) in; Primary Industry- optimising our land use Adding Value – processing our primary products Marine – maximising our USP Tourism – continue to increase our product offering

  5. Primary Industries Sector • Currently employs 12.7% of our work force and a quotient of 2.5 • Focus on • Agriculture • Forestry • Horticulture • Aquaculture • Mining and Minerals

  6. Adding Value Sector • Currently employs 9.2% of our work force, with a quotient of 2.4 • Focus on • Food processing • Wood processing • Marine technology and engineering

  7. Marine Sector • Black boat build and repair • Super-yacht build and refit • Launch repair and refit

  8. Tourism Sector • Currently employs 17.8% of the workforce and has a quotient of 1.2 • Focus on • Increasing product offering • Target specific overseas markets • Working with Auckland • Marketing the whole of Northland
